You are required to use TDS 5. And then i has to delete the old Driver jar file in the specified classpath, and then put the Driver File freshly. The “No suitable driver” exception is thrown by the DriverManager when none of the registered Driver implementations recognizes the supplied URL. This means among other things that it cannot access platform-specific features, such as determining the currently logged user and his credentials. If you experience this problem with versions 0. I have used the following code for java database connectivity with SQL Server import java.

Uploader: Vudomuro
Date Added: 12 March 2012
File Size: 45.62 Mb
Operating Systems: Windows NT/2000/XP/2003/2003/7/8/10 MacOS 10/X
Downloads: 27267
Price: Free* [*Free Regsitration Required]

When jTDS sends the 8.

Incorrect Behavior CallableStatement output parameter getter throws java. Class-Path May 16, 9: You are very probably using TDS 4.

This is what happens with SQL Server-returned errors and warnings and is consistent with how other drivers handle exceptions.

I didn’t find the answer to my problem in this FAQ. If you can’t figure out why, ask your network administrator for help.

Memory Usage Jxbc usage keeps increasing when using generated PreparedStatements. Please be thoughtful, detailed and courteous, and adhere to our posting rules. Until telnet doesn’t connect, jTDS won’t either. ClassNotFoundError is thrown by the classloader when it can not find a certain class.

Why do I get a java. Properties can be passed to jTDS in one of three ways: Please note that this flag only alters the internetcd of executeUpdate ; execute will still return all update counts.


Download Microsoft SQL Server JDBC Driver 2.0 from Official Microsoft Download Center

The solution is to set the “TDS” property to “4. Why do I still need to provide a username and password?

Driver class, which means that jtds. Actually we do have benchmark results from two different benchmarks, both developed by large commercial SQL Server JDBC driver vendors to demonstrate the performance of their own drivers. The set of properties supported by jTDS is:.

otFoundException: Alin,

inhernetcds May 16, 9: If you need help with any other jTDS-related issue, search the Help forum first and if you still don’t find anything, post a question.

You can control the real batch size using the batchSize parameter; setting it to a non-zero value will break up batches into smaller pieces on execution, hopefully avoiding the problem. CallableStatement output parameter getter throws java.

The number of statements that are kept open simultaneously can be controlled with the maxStatements parameter; see the jTDS URL format for more information. Why do column names more than 30 characters long, get chopped off at 30 characters?

java.lang.ClassNotFoundException: com.internetcds.jdbc.tds.DriverAlin,

So for procedures returning ResultSet s you will have to loop, consuming all results before reading the output parameters i. Will meet you later.


If you encountered an issue that you have tested and retested and you’re sure it’s a bug, use the Bugs link on onternetcds of the page. The only major features missing from jTDS are connection pooling and row sets; the reason for leaving these out is that there are free implementations available, probably much better than anything we could come up with.

Where does one place an instance name in the connect string?

java – JDBC Driver for SQL Server , Class not | DaniWeb

While doing this it times out, throwing the exception you see which means intrnetcds jTDS was not able to get information about the running instances. No suitable driver what’s wrong with my same code, no changes made In this case it’s the net. In case you are wondering if this is right, this is a quote from the CallableStatement API documentation: In this case the driver will be able to use an RPC succesfully as all the parameters are represented by parameter markers?